Women's Indoor Soccer Rules

Minimum players on court/roster: 3
Maximum players on roster: 10
Maximum players on court: 5 

The basic rules of soccer set forth in the NCAA rule book will be used (no hand balls, pushing, etc.). A legal roster may have as many current Varsity or JV soccer players on it (this includes seniors who have finished their fourth year). However, there can only be one (and only one) of them on the court at any given time. If no active Varsity or JV players are on the roster, then a maximum of two former Varsity or JV volleyball players may be on the court at a time. If there is an active Varsity or JV player then only one former player and one current player may be on the court at a time.

  • NCAA rule book exceptions:
    • There will be no offside rule.
    • There will be no out-of-bounds, i.e. everything is in play except when the ball goes into a neighboring basketball court. The team that did not touch the ball last puts it into play with a free kick on the side line where it went out of bounds.
  • Rules specific to our gym:
    • There is no specific goalkeeper but someone may guard the goal while playing defense. When guarding the goal, you must remain outside a two foot radius of the goal. No standing right in front of the goal.
    • No black-soled shoes allowed in gym. Bring a second pair of shoes to prevent the floor from getting wet.
    • The ball must enter the Pugg goal to score. Shots that bounce off the wall before being shot are permitted. Balls that lodge in the back side of the Pugg goal will be put into play with a defense kick.
    • If a hand ball occurs immediately in front of the goal, whether intentionally or unintentionally, a free kick will occur from the three-point line as drawn on the basketball floor. There are to be no wall of defenders trying to deflect this shot. It is truly a free kick. However, if a hand ball occurs up to three feet away from the goal, revert back to normal soccer rules.

Time and player specification:

  • Two 20-minute halves with a running clock. 
  • Five minute break for half time.
  • Ties will stand in the regular season. Playoffs will have a sudden death overtime.
  • No time outs may be called. 
  • Forefeit time is ten minutes past scheduled game time. 

A maximum of five players will play for a team at one time. You must have a minimum of three players on a team. A forfeit will be called if there are six players on the floor.

  • Substitutes may be made at any time provided they do not take advantage of the situation.
  • Intentional or blatant fouls will result in immediate dismissal from the game (red card).
